module Proverb

let finalLine (input: string list) = "And all for the want of a " + (List.head input) + "."

let getLists (input: string list) = (List.take ((List.length input) - 1) input, List.tail input)

let getItemPairs (input: string list) =
let lists = getLists input
let a = lists |> fst
let b = lists |> snd
List.zip a b

let getLines (input: string list) = List.map (fun i ->
let a = i |> fst
let b = i |> snd
"For want of a " + a + " the " + b + " was lost.") (getItemPairs input)

let recite (input: string list): string list = if not (List.isEmpty input) then getLines input @ [finalLine input] else []

# Proverb

For want of a horseshoe nail, a kingdom was lost, or so the saying goes.

Given a list of inputs, generate the relevant proverb. For example, given the list `["nail", "shoe", "horse", "rider", "message", "battle", "kingdom"]`, you will output the full text of this proverbial rhyme:

```text
For want of a nail the shoe was lost.
For want of a shoe the horse was lost.
For want of a horse the rider was lost.
For want of a rider the message was lost.
For want of a message the battle was lost.
For want of a battle the kingdom was lost.
And all for the want of a nail.
```

Note that the list of inputs may vary; your solution should be able to handle lists of arbitrary length and content. No line of the output text should be a static, unchanging string; all should vary according to the input given.

## Hints
- Try to capture the structure of the song in your code, where you build up the song by composing its parts.


## Running the tests

To run the tests, run the command `dotnet test` from within the exercise directory.
